How you will make an impact: 
As the Director of Nursing at Golden Lodge Assisted Living & Memory Care, you will be responsible for overseeing daily nursing operations, ensuring high-quality resident care, and maintaining regulatory compliance. This leadership role involves supervising nursing staff, coordinating resident care plans, and collaborating with residents, families, and the interdisciplinary team to promote a safe, supportive environment. Key duties include managing clinical oversight, medication administration, and infection control; leading staff training and development; ensuring adherence to Colorado assisted living regulations and Department of Health standards; and serving as a liaison for families and healthcare partners to support resident well-being.

What you will need: 

  • Must be a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) or Registered Nurse (RN) in the state of Colorado (required).
  • Minimum of 2-3 years of nursing leadership experience, preferably in an assisted living, skilled nursing, or long-term care setting (required).
  • Strong knowledge of Colorado assisted living regulations and resident rights (required).
  • Excellent communication, organizational, and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to collaborate effectively with residents, families, staff, and external healthcare providers.
  • Passion for senior care and person-centered services.
